WebTo freeze cooked shrimp safely, you can follow this step by step guide: Step 1: Allow for the cooked shrimp to cool to room temperature. Keep in mind that cooked shrimp can’t be left out at room temperature for more than two hours, as it will quickly become unsafe to consume. This step should take very little time. WebNov 7, 2024 · Fresh Prawns (cooked or raw) that have never been frozen, can be frozen for up to 3 months at -18ºC or below. If you plan to freeze Prawns, ask your fishmonger whether they have already been frozen and thawed – if so, use them as soon as possible and do not refreeze.
